How can I purchase digital currencies without the need for a middleman?
I'm interested in purchasing digital currencies, but I want to avoid using a middleman. Is there a way to buy cryptocurrencies directly without relying on a third party? What options are available for purchasing digital currencies peer-to-peer or without intermediaries?

- SalimaSep 11, 2025 · 7 months agoAbsolutely! One option to purchase digital currencies without a middleman is through peer-to-peer (P2P) exchanges. P2P exchanges connect buyers and sellers directly, allowing you to buy cryptocurrencies directly from other individuals. This eliminates the need for intermediaries like traditional exchanges. Some popular P2P platforms include LocalBitcoins and Paxful. Just be sure to research and choose a reputable platform with good user reviews before making any transactions.
- Nika KovalenkoMay 29, 2025 · 10 months agoYou bet! If you want to avoid middlemen and buy digital currencies directly, decentralized exchanges (DEXs) are worth exploring. DEXs operate on blockchain technology and allow users to trade cryptocurrencies directly with each other, without the need for a central authority. They provide a more secure and private way to buy and sell digital assets. Some popular DEXs include Uniswap and SushiSwap. Keep in mind that DEXs may have lower liquidity compared to centralized exchanges, so it's important to do your due diligence before trading.

- Kawsar KawsarJan 25, 2022 · 4 years agoSure thing! Another way to purchase digital currencies without intermediaries is through over-the-counter (OTC) trading. OTC trading involves buying or selling cryptocurrencies directly with a counterparty, without the need for an exchange. OTC trades are usually conducted by brokers or market makers, and they offer more privacy and flexibility compared to traditional exchanges. If you're interested in OTC trading, you can reach out to OTC desks or brokers that specialize in digital asset trading.

- low_layer's_funJun 18, 2025 · 10 months agoAbsolutely! If you want to buy digital currencies without intermediaries, you can consider using atomic swaps. Atomic swaps are a technology that enables the direct exchange of cryptocurrencies between different blockchain networks without the need for a middleman. This allows you to trade digital assets securely and privately. Atomic swaps can be done through specialized wallets or platforms that support this feature. Keep in mind that atomic swaps may have limitations in terms of supported cryptocurrencies and liquidity, so it's essential to check compatibility before initiating a swap.
